About Starting a Business in South Miami
South Miami offers entrepreneurs a vibrant location in Miami-Dade County with access to one of Florida's most dynamic business ecosystems. Located in the heart of South Florida, this city benefits from proximity to Miami's diverse economy, which spans retail, hospitality, professional services, and healthcare. The area features a strong residential and commercial real estate market, making it attractive for service-based businesses, wellness companies, and retail ventures.
South Miami's walkable downtown and established commercial corridors along US-1 provide visibility for storefronts and offices. While the cost of living is higher than many Florida cities, it reflects the area's desirability and economic activity. The city has coworking options available to support flexible workspace needs.
Entrepreneurs seeking grants and SBA resources should explore Miami-Dade County and state-level funding opportunities. The region's overall business infrastructure and proximity to Miami's broader entrepreneurial network provide meaningful advantages for startup founders.

Starting a Business in South Miami — FAQ
What do I need to start a business in South Miami, FL?
To start a business in South Miami, you'll need to register your business with the State of Florida and obtain an Employer Identification Number (EIN) from the IRS. Depending on your industry, you may need local occupancy permits, professional licenses, or health department approvals from Miami-Dade County. You should also register for Florida sales tax if applicable and check with South Miami's City Hall regarding any local business licensing requirements specific to your location.

What free business help is available in South Miami?
While SparkLocal shows 0 SBA resources currently listed in South Miami, you can access free consulting through SCORE, a nonprofit organization offering free mentorship from experienced business professionals. The Small Business Development Center (SBDC) serves Miami-Dade County and provides free business planning, market research, and financing guidance. Miami-Dade County's Department of Small Business Development and the South Miami Chamber of Commerce are valuable local contacts for business support, networking, and information about local regulations.
